When you make a repository public on Hugging Face, every other user on the platform automatically gets a permanent, irrevocable right to use, copy, share, and build on your content — and you cannot take that permission back.
This analysis describes what Hugging Face's agreement states, permits, or reserves. It does not constitute a legal determination about enforceability. Regulatory applicability and practical outcomes may vary by jurisdiction, enforcement context, and individual circumstances. Read our methodology
The clause defines the scope of rights granted upon public designation of a Repository. By setting a Repository public, the user grants specified usage and derivative rights to all platform users under an irrevocable license structure, establishing the operational framework for content distribution and reuse within the platform.
Any model weights, datasets, or code published to a public Hugging Face repository are permanently licensed to all users worldwide with no ability to revoke — making accidental public disclosure of proprietary or sensitive content irreversible.
